编程4个阶段叫什么名字

fiy 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程的发展可以划分为四个阶段,它们分别是:机器语言阶段、汇编语言阶段、高级语言阶段和现代编程阶段。

    1. 机器语言阶段:在计算机发展的早期阶段,程序员需要直接使用机器语言来编写程序。机器语言是由二进制代码表示的,对程序员来说非常复杂和困难。在这个阶段,编程的主要任务是将程序员的指令翻译成计算机可以理解的机器语言。

    2. 汇编语言阶段:随着计算机技术的发展,汇编语言应运而生。汇编语言是一种与机器语言相对应的低级语言,使用助记符来代替二进制代码。相比于机器语言,汇编语言更加易读和易懂。在这个阶段,程序员需要通过编写汇编语言来实现程序的功能。

    3. 高级语言阶段:随着计算机的普及和软件需求的增加,高级语言逐渐成为主流。高级语言是一种与机器无关的编程语言,它使用更接近人类语言的语法结构,使程序员能够更加高效地编写程序。高级语言具有丰富的函数库和开发工具,使得编程变得更加便捷和灵活。

    4. 现代编程阶段:随着计算机技术的不断进步,编程方式也在不断演变。现代编程阶段包括了各种编程范式、开发框架和开发工具的出现。例如,面向对象编程(OOP)和函数式编程(FP)等范式,以及各种流行的编程语言和开发平台。现代编程注重代码的可维护性、可扩展性和可重用性,旨在提高开发效率和代码质量。

    总之,编程的发展经历了机器语言阶段、汇编语言阶段、高级语言阶段和现代编程阶段,每个阶段都有着不同的特点和优势,推动着计算机技术的不断进步。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程通常可以分为以下四个阶段:

    1. 分析和设计阶段:在这个阶段,程序员需要与客户或者项目团队进行沟通,了解需求和目标。然后,他们会进行需求分析和系统设计,确定程序的功能、数据结构和算法等方面的细节。

    2. 编码阶段:一旦系统的设计和需求明确,程序员就可以开始编写代码了。在这个阶段,他们需要使用编程语言来实现系统的功能。他们可能需要使用不同的工具和技术,如集成开发环境(IDE)、调试器等来帮助他们编写高质量的代码。

    3. 测试和调试阶段:在编码完成后,程序员需要对其进行测试和调试,以确保代码的正确性和可靠性。他们会使用测试工具和技术来验证程序的功能和性能,并修复任何错误或问题。

    4. 部署和维护阶段:一旦程序经过测试并且没有问题,它就可以部署到生产环境中使用了。在这个阶段,程序员可能需要进行一些配置和安装工作,以确保程序能够正常运行。此外,他们还需要监控程序的运行状态,并及时修复任何出现的问题,以确保系统的稳定性和可用性。

    这些阶段是编程过程中不可或缺的步骤,每个阶段都有其独特的任务和挑战。通过合理地进行这些阶段的工作,程序员可以开发出高质量的软件和应用程序。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程可以分为四个阶段,分别是需求分析、设计、编码和测试。

    一、需求分析阶段
    需求分析阶段是软件开发的第一步,目的是明确用户的需求和期望。在这个阶段,开发团队与客户进行沟通,了解用户的具体需求,并将其转化为软件功能和特性的需求规范。这个阶段的主要任务包括:

    1. 收集用户需求:与客户进行面对面的交流,了解用户的需求和期望。
    2. 分析用户需求:对收集到的需求进行整理和分析,确保理解准确并且没有冲突。
    3. 确定需求规范:将用户需求转化为详细的需求规范文档,包括功能需求、非功能需求等。

    二、设计阶段
    设计阶段是在需求分析阶段的基础上,根据需求规范来进行系统设计和架构设计。这个阶段的主要任务包括:

    1. 系统设计:确定系统的整体架构,包括模块划分、组件设计等。
    2. 数据库设计:设计系统所需的数据库结构,包括表的设计、关系的建立等。
    3. 用户界面设计:设计用户界面的布局、样式和交互方式。
    4. 安全设计:考虑系统的安全性,设计合适的安全措施和防护机制。

    三、编码阶段
    编码阶段是根据设计阶段的设计文档来进行具体的编码实现。这个阶段的主要任务包括:

    1. 编写源代码:根据设计文档编写源代码,实现系统的各个功能。
    2. 软件测试:编写单元测试和集成测试来验证代码的正确性和系统的稳定性。

    四、测试阶段
    测试阶段是对已经编码完成的软件进行全面的测试,以确保软件满足需求并具有稳定的性能。这个阶段的主要任务包括:

    1. 单元测试:对各个模块进行单独的测试,验证每个模块的功能是否正常。
    2. 集成测试:将各个模块组合起来进行测试,验证模块之间的协同工作。
    3. 系统测试:对整个系统进行全面的测试,验证系统的功能和性能是否符合要求。
    4. 用户验收测试:将系统交给用户进行测试,验证系统是否满足用户需求。

    以上就是编程的四个阶段的详细解释,每个阶段都有各自的任务和目标,通过有序的进行可以提高软件开发的效率和质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部